The past week for the Islanders was nothing short of a whirlwind, marked by a series of emotional highs and lows that left fans on the edge of their seats. After a disheartening loss to the struggling Blackhawks, which seemed to cast a shadow over their season, the team rebounded with a gritty victory against Dallas. Though not flawless, the win provided a much-needed sense of relief. Then came Saturday’s matinee, a game that began in bleak despair but soared to euphoric heights as the out-of-town scoreboard favored the Islanders following a crucial win over the Panthers. This rollercoaster week was a testament to the unpredictable nature of the NHL, reminding fans what it feels like to be an Islander, even amid the anxiety.
As the team gears up for another pivotal week, the stakes are higher than ever. With two sets of back-to-backs on the horizon, the Islanders face a gauntlet of Eastern Conference opponents who are either hot on their heels or could pose significant challenges in the postseason. Monday’s matchup against the Penguins stands out as the most critical, but they must also contend with the resurging Sabres, the Flyers who have re-entered the playoff conversation, and the ever-present Hurricanes, a familiar foe in the playoff landscape. The Islanders can ill afford to let their guard down; every mistake could prove costly.
